Abstract:
This is a reprint of trade and vessel records from the Massachusetts archives noting occurrences of trade with the Carolinas between 1686 and 1709. The introduction provides background information on the records and the circumstance of their establishment as well as period trade information.

Abstract:
This article seeks to build upon previous historians' work on the history of commercial shipping activities in North Carolina including the naval stores trade, provisions trade, lumber products shipping, and tobacco exportation. The author examines the Aaron Lopez papers who was a Rhode Island merchant actively involved in dispatching at least 37 voyages to North Carolina between 1761 and 1775.
